Transaction bbb41b65a7ed79ae73da83e4ef91a523e34ea2453ec1326b157a06d3a59eb416

1 Input
2 Outputs
  • bbb41b65a7ed79ae73da83e4ef91a523e34ea2453ec1326b157a06d3a59eb416:0
  • value  6028272
    address  3PshhRXCSAk7Fi1KNXFpmbUp4UERZgzRbC
  • bbb41b65a7ed79ae73da83e4ef91a523e34ea2453ec1326b157a06d3a59eb416:1
  • value  146339957
    address  3MLqQWt7v1avCLHPxabSgWyxoyfVL43mxP